Output e32b68d326a23c3dc1e60a61c735f0a28d1f8d15ace92b08242602904bf25315:14
- value
- 40861963
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e4a7b5eb8be6f821353798ed60f3a6a763a9054 OP_EQUAL
- address
- 34TBRPjaH4u18wLXoq3dJKePj3bPYAFYN2
- transaction
- e32b68d326a23c3dc1e60a61c735f0a28d1f8d15ace92b08242602904bf25315
- spent
- true